Shopify店铺升级(版本)注意事项
Shopify每季度发布重大版本更新,不当升级可能导致30%的定制功能失效。安全升级需要遵循"测试-备份-实施"的黄金流程,特别关注第三方应用与主题模板的兼容性问题。
升级前兼容性检查清单。在开发者环境安装待升级版本,重点测试:结账流程(特别是自定义字段)、API调用频次、主题模板的liquid语法变动。记录所有deprecated功能警告。

备份策略双重保障。除系统自动备份外,手动导出关键数据:产品CSV(含metafield)、主题代码包、导航结构截图。使用Git进行版本控制,标注升级前最后一个稳定commit。
第三方应用升级顺序。先升级支付网关等核心应用,再处理营销工具,最后更新辅助插件。遇到循环依赖时(如A应用要求B应用先升级),联系开发商获取迁移脚本。
定制功能特别处理。对比changelog检查废弃API,重写受影响的自定义模块。涉及checkout.liquid修改的店铺,必须测试10种以上支付组合场景。
灰度发布实施方案。通过流量分配功能先对5%用户开放新版本,监测转化率变化。重点关注移动端用户行为,60%的兼容性问题出现在iOS系统。
回滚应急方案设计。准备三套回滚方案:24小时内的系统快照恢复、72小时内的数据库回档、超过72天的手动数据迁移。回滚决策应在异常持续2小时后启动。
升级后监控指标。建立7天观察期,特别监控:平均加载时间(容忍值+15%)、购物车放弃率(阈值2%)、移动端JS错误数。使用Hotjar记录用户操作卡点。
文档更新同步要求。新版本上线48小时内更新:员工操作手册、API开发文档、客户帮助中心。遗留功能标注"即将淘汰"提示,给出替代方案指引。
(文章内容属作者个人观点,不代表CoGoLinks结行国际赞同其观点和立场。本文经作者授权转载,转载需经原作者授权同意)
升级前兼容性检查清单。在开发者环境安装待升级版本,重点测试:结账流程(特别是自定义字段)、API调用频次、主题模板的liquid语法变动。记录所有deprecated功能警告。

备份策略双重保障。除系统自动备份外,手动导出关键数据:产品CSV(含metafield)、主题代码包、导航结构截图。使用Git进行版本控制,标注升级前最后一个稳定commit。
第三方应用升级顺序。先升级支付网关等核心应用,再处理营销工具,最后更新辅助插件。遇到循环依赖时(如A应用要求B应用先升级),联系开发商获取迁移脚本。
定制功能特别处理。对比changelog检查废弃API,重写受影响的自定义模块。涉及checkout.liquid修改的店铺,必须测试10种以上支付组合场景。
灰度发布实施方案。通过流量分配功能先对5%用户开放新版本,监测转化率变化。重点关注移动端用户行为,60%的兼容性问题出现在iOS系统。
回滚应急方案设计。准备三套回滚方案:24小时内的系统快照恢复、72小时内的数据库回档、超过72天的手动数据迁移。回滚决策应在异常持续2小时后启动。
升级后监控指标。建立7天观察期,特别监控:平均加载时间(容忍值+15%)、购物车放弃率(阈值2%)、移动端JS错误数。使用Hotjar记录用户操作卡点。
文档更新同步要求。新版本上线48小时内更新:员工操作手册、API开发文档、客户帮助中心。遗留功能标注"即将淘汰"提示,给出替代方案指引。
(文章内容属作者个人观点,不代表CoGoLinks结行国际赞同其观点和立场。本文经作者授权转载,转载需经原作者授权同意)








